Why won't my dishwasher drain?

Standing water usually means a clogged filter or drain hose, a failed drain pump, or a stuck check valve. We clear or replace the culprit and confirm it drains fully before we leave.

Is it worth fixing a dishwasher that won't dry?

Often yes. Poor drying is frequently a failed heating element, vent, or rinse-aid dispenser rather than a dead machine. We will tell you if replacement is the smarter call.
